What is the Charitable Facility?

The Charitable Facility is an LLL investment option that lets you keep funds invested while forgoing the interest that would normally be paid to you. LLL then allocates funds to approved program beneficiaries, taking into account your non-binding nominated preference.

Who can invest in the Charitable Facility?

Eligible Supporters include individuals, families and organisations, subject to LLL's Terms and Conditions.

Does my LLL Charitable Facility accrue any interest?

No, any interest on the Facility is foregone entirely. In lieu of paying you interest LLL will apply Allocations to Program Beneficiaries.

Is there a minimum or maximum investment limitation?

No, you may support participating Beneficiaries, including your preferred Cause, as little or as much as you see fit through holding funds in your LLL Charitable Facility.

I am a pensioner. Will participating in the Program affect my entitlements for my age pension?

Participating in the Program should not affect your pension entitlements. However, we recommend that you obtain independent financial advice that considers your unique circumstances.

Can I change the Cause I support?

Yes. You can change your nominated Cause or Beneficiary at any time by contacting LLL.

Will my nominated Cause receive all of my foregone interest?

You can nominate your preferred Cause or Beneficiary, but allocations remain at LLL's discretion. As part of the Program, interest foregone from funds maintained in a Charitable Facility by supporters enables LLL to allocate funds to a variety of community organisations as beneficiaries. The allocation is based on the organisation's needs and missional objectives, and in consideration of supporters' preferences.

What happens to my support when the project or Cause ends?

If your nominated project or Cause ends, LLL will use its discretion to direct support to the next most appropriate option - such as a similar cause, a general-purpose cause for that organisation, or another area of strong missional need, that either:

  • Aligns with your original preferred cause, or
  • Is a new cause or a general-purpose cause established by your preferred organisation, or
  • Has a strong need for missional funding.

What features does the Charitable Facility attract?

The Charitable Facility operates under the same Terms and Conditions as LLL's Notice of Withdrawal Facility, except that interest is not paid to the Supporter and LLL instead makes allocations under the Program.

Who can open a Charitable Facility?

Adults, children aged 12 years or older, and businesses**. The Facility may be set up with either single or joint signatories.

Can I choose to retain some of my interest held in a Charitable Facility?

No, all interest that notionally accrues against funds maintained in an LLL Charitable Facility are foregone entirely and retained by LLL. This enables LLL to allocate its funds to a variety of community organisations with reference to the organisation's needs, its missional objectives, and your Preferences.

Should you wish to accrue interest for personal wealth, it is suggested that a separate LLL Facility is opened and maintained.

What is the rate that is forgone with the Charitable Facility?

Interest on Charitable Facilities is calculated daily and allocated to the nominated Cause quarterly, at an interest rate that is equal to the interest rate of the LLL Notice of Withdrawal Facility.

Can I support multiple Causes?

Yes. You can support multiple Causes. Each Cause requires a separate Charitable Facility, so you may choose as many different Causes and organisations as you wish.

Will the Beneficiary be able to identify me as the Supporter?

No, the Allocation made to your Beneficiary by the LLL will be done so anonymously; they will only receive data showing Supporter numbers and total funding received.

How will I know how much impact my support has made?

LLL will provide a quarterly report containing the details of your Foregone Interest, and how your preferred Beneficiary has benefited through the Program.

How can I increase my support for my nominated cause?

You can increase your support by adding more funds to your Charitable Facility or by opening additional Charitable Facilities for other eligible Causes. You may also choose to share information about the Program with others who may wish to participate.

Can I withdraw my investment?

Yes. The Charitable Facility follows the same withdrawal terms as LLL's Notice of Withdrawal Facility, with withdrawals available after 31 days' written notice.

What are the minimum eligibility requirements to be a Beneficiary of the Program?

To be eligible as a Beneficiary of the Program, organisations must:

  • Be a tax-exempt organisation.
  • Be approved as an LLL Associate* customer
  • Maintain an LLL Facility and/or Loan.
  • Organisations may hold dual roles as both Benefactor and Supporter, provided these roles do not apply to the same Cause.

Can I nominate an external bank account to receive my organisation's Allocation?

No, an LLL Facility or Loan must be nominated to receive the Allocation; you can choose where the funds are received in a new or existing facility, either:

  • LLL Instant Access and/or LLL Notice of Withdrawal
  • LLL Loan

What fees or charges apply to the Program?

LLL Facilities do not attract fees or charges, and there are no separate fees for participating in the Program. Enjoy peace of mind that funds held in your facility and that of your Supporters won't be diminished by fees and charges.

After the Allocation is received, will it accrue interest?

It depends on the Facility you nominate.

If the Allocation is received in an LLL Instant Access or Notice of Withdrawal Facility, they attract interest the day after receipt. Funds received into an LLL Loan Facility will reduce the Beneficiary's Loan balance.

Can I raise funds for multiple Causes?

Yes. You can raise funds for numerous Causes. To ensure transparency about which Cause Supporters are supporting, we recommend operating separate LLL Facilities for each Cause, allowing these Causes to run simultaneously.

Will I be able to identify individual Supporters?

No, you will receive quarterly reports with anonymous data showing Supporter numbers and total funding received.

When will the Allocation be received in my Facility or Loan ?

LLL calculates the notional rate daily and distributes the Allocation quarterly on the last day of the quarter, i.e. 31 March, 30 June, 30 September and 31 December. The Allocation will be transferred to your nominated Facility or Loan shortly thereafter.

What happens to the Allocations once my Cause is complete?

You can update the Cause after completion to a new Cause or make it a general-purpose Cause. The choice is yours, though we recommend that you communicate this change to your community.
